-yesChronicRecords wrote:Massive wobble sync automation question for FL:
In massive in FL , What would be the best way to change around the sync'd lfo speed of a wobble multiple times to mutliple speeds such as 1/4 , 1/8, 1/12, 1/16 in a 8 bar time frame and record that.
ive tried pressing the record button in FL and moving the lfo ratio thing with my mouse but it doesnt record the movements. doesnt work.
Tried Slicing different clips that were each set to a different speed, then putting them together but when i use the knife tool it cuts out large portions of my note and i cant get the wobbles to change at precise times like in between a fast 1/16th wobble... plus to do it this way is a huge amount of work if you want to change the speeds alot..
I think it would be easier if i could just record the movements of my mouse in massive somehow when im switching between speeds, so every 8 bars it will change between speeds on its own? Anyway to do anything like this ?

* in both cases i cant edit the lfo rate with or without sync enabled
* ok .... you can but you have to assign one of the macro control's to the lfo rate then .... you cant goto last tweaked event you need to goto
view > browser
look in the browser for 'current project' open this foldout
click this then look for 'generators' open this foldout
look for your instance of 'ni massive' open the settings
then scroll through the settings till you see 1,2,3,4,5,6,7,8 depending on which macro you want to automate ;0)
